The Memorial to the Fallen of the Red Army is a memorial created by Ernst Sauer in the town of Senftenberg. It is located on Briesker Straße west of the New Cemetery. It is a listed building. The memorial commemorates the fallen Soviet soldiers of the 1st Ukrainian Front under General Konev, who liberated Senftenberg from 19 to 20 April 1945. In the immediate vicinity of the memorial is the cemetery of honour for the fallen soldiers.
On the 30th anniversary of the liberation, it was decided to redesign the burial place of the soldiers who died in April 1945. The Senftenberg sculptor Ernst Sauer was commissioned. The memorial was inaugurated on May 8, 1975, and was present, among others, by the first commander of the Soviet District Command, retired Guard Colonel Ivan Soldatov. During this redesign, the gravestones of the more than 120 soldiers were removed. In 2015, the monument was renovated and opened on 1 September 2015. During this renovation, plaques with the names of the fallen soldiers were installed in Cyrillic script. In the entrance area, steles provide information about the monument and the events of the war.
